引言
Qubes OS 是一个基于虚拟化的操作系统,以其安全特性和模块化设计而闻名。它采用了“安全通过隔离”的原则,将不同的操作任务分配到不同的虚拟机(VM)中,从而提高了系统的安全性。本文将深入探讨 Qubes OS 的激活密钥(Bootstrapping Key)及其在系统安全中的作用,并提供一些实战技巧。
激活密钥:安全之旅的起点
激活密钥的概念
激活密钥(也称为引导密钥)是 Qubes OS 在安装过程中生成的一对密钥。它用于加密系统启动时的引导过程,确保系统在没有恶意修改的情况下启动。激活密钥的生成是 Qubes OS 安全架构的重要组成部分。
密钥的生成和存储
在安装 Qubes OS 时,系统会自动生成一对密钥:公钥和私钥。公钥存储在系统分区中,而私钥则存储在用户的个人存储设备上,如 USB 驱动器。这种设计确保了即使系统分区被篡改,私钥也不会暴露。
安全奥秘:激活密钥的作用
防御恶意软件
激活密钥的存在使得恶意软件难以在 Qubes OS 中立足。由于密钥用于加密引导过程,任何对引导阶段的篡改都会导致系统无法启动,从而阻止了恶意软件的传播。
保障系统启动安全
通过使用激活密钥,Qubes OS 确保了系统启动时的安全性。在启动过程中,系统会验证激活密钥的完整性,如果发现任何异常,系统将不会启动,从而避免了潜在的攻击。
实战技巧
管理激活密钥
- 备份密钥:确保将激活密钥的私钥备份到安全的位置,以防丢失。
- 定期更换:虽然激活密钥在安装后很少需要更换,但定期更换可以进一步提高安全性。
安全启动过程
- 验证启动分区:在启动过程中,确保系统从可信的启动分区启动。
- 监控启动日志:定期检查启动日志,以发现任何异常情况。
使用 Qubes OS 的最佳实践
- 隔离任务:将不同的操作任务分配到不同的虚拟机中,以减少潜在的攻击面。
- 使用 Qubes Manager:Qubes Manager 是一个图形界面工具,可以帮助用户管理虚拟机和安全设置。
结论
Qubes OS 的激活密钥是系统安全的关键组成部分,它通过加密引导过程和确保系统启动安全来提高整体安全性。了解激活密钥的作用和管理技巧对于使用 Qubes OS 的用户来说至关重要。通过遵循最佳实践,用户可以进一步提高系统安全性,享受 Qubes OS 提供的强大安全特性。